Yes, indeed, we are now on the air all day in English and all day in Spanish. The liftoff was this morning and went off without a hitch. We go on the air at 5:00 AM, so Peter and I both got there a little ahead of time to move the AM feed to the new dedicated AM computer’s control console and also do some file maintenance that can’t be done while we are broadcasting.

We have spent the rest of the day fine tuning the various settings and automatic file copying processes. A little before lunch I started working on the computer that used to be in our middle production studio. When I get done it will be our new FM broadcast computer. That will take several days to set up and we’ll want to test it for a day or two so it doesn’t give us any unpleasant surprises once it’s on the air.

We are highly excited about our expanded programming hours and the new speakers (preaching/teaching programs) we have on HRGS. Tomorrow (Tuesday), for example, we’ll have the following English lineup:

FM

  • 7:00 – The Islander’s Hour may be our longest running program. I think it goes all the way back to 1990.
  • 7:30 – The HRGS Update, which you can listen to using the player at the bottom of this page.
  • 8:00 - Turning Point with Dr. David Jeremiah. We started airing this several months ago and it’s been well received.
  • 8:30 – Guidelines with Dr. Harold Sala.
  • 8:42 – The Love Language Minute with Dr. Gary Chapman.
  • 8:45 – Stories of Great Christians from Moody.
  • 9:00 – Building Relationships with Dr. Gary Chapman. This is a new-to-us weekly one-hour program that we’ll be repeating on Saturday on the AM.
  • 10:00 – Thru the Bible with Dr. J. Vernon McGee.
  • 11:00 – Grace to You with Dr. John MacArthur.
  • 11:35 – Revive our Hearts with Nancy Leigh DeMoss. Another recent addition that seems to be a hit.
  • 12:00 – Request and Dedication, our all time most popular program.
  • 1:00 – Love Worth Finding with Dr. Adrian Rogers.
  • 2:00 – Insight for Living with Dr. Chuck Swindoll. This is a new program during our extended FM English broadcast. We have been airing Insight for Living Weekend for quite a while now.

AM

  • 3:00 - Precepts for Life with Kay Arthur. This is another new program for our female listeners.
  • 4:00 – Family Life with Dennis Rainey, yet another of our new programs.
  • 5:00 – Revive our Hearts is a repeat of the one aired at 11:35 on FM. It’s one that we have had a lot of positive feedback about.
  • 6:30 – Keys for Kids. This little program also airs at 6:30 AM during Sunrise Serenade.
  • 6:45 – Mission Network News. This is another repeat from Sunrise Serenade.
  • 7:00 – The Islander’s Hour, repeating the morning program.
  • 7:30 – Bible Basics, a program written and produced by our own mission, Bible Basics International.
  • 8:00 – Living on the Edge is a new-to-us program with Chip Ingram.
  • 9:00 – Walk in the Word with James MacDonald. This is another program that will be airing for the first time tonight.

If I counted right, there are six brand new programs slated for Tuesdays. We have a few other new ones coming up on the weekends such as Sports Spectrum. I’m still wrapping my brain around it all and wishing we could receive our own AM signal here at our houses and at the station.
